On Tue, 4 Dec 2007, Alan Cox wrote: > On Tue, Dec 04, 2007 at 11:06:55AM -0500, Eric Paris wrote: > > Given a specifically crafted binary do_brk() can be used to get low > > pages available in userspace virtually memory and can thus be used to > > circumvent the mmap_min_addr low memory protection. Add security checks > > in do_brk(). > > > > Signed-off-by: Eric Paris <[EMAIL PROTECTED]> > > ACK
